Leica will release a ghost version of the Q2 limited edition camera

0

LeicaRumors said that Leica will release a limited edition camera with the co-branded Ghost Edition Q2 on the 15th, the new machine is similar to the M10-P Ghost Edition.

At the same time, they also released a picture of a suspected spy shot of the new camera.

Leica 2019 launched the ghost version of the paraxial camera M10-P, the workmanship is quite ultimately beautiful, with the Leica Summilux-M 35mm f / 1.4 ASPH large aperture fixed focus lens, also equipped with a special black leather shoulder strap, a total of only 250 sets of limited, priced at about RMB 100,000.

The camera is said to be inspired by the faded bezel of an old timepiece owned by HODINKEE founder and CEO Ben Clymer, claiming to be a tribute to the coveted “phantom” aesthetic created by the natural aging and wear of a hand watch bezel.
